Cheesecake with Berry Sauce
Cheesecake with berry sauce from Spoonsparrow: Ready to serve!
Ingredients
- 180 g oats (or oat cookies)
- 110 g butter
- 45 g whole oats
- 0.5 tsp vanilla powder
- 800 g cream cheese (quarter-fat; 10% fat in total)
- 200 g Sour Cream
- 100 g Granulated Sugar
- 4 eggs (medium size)
- 40 g cornstarch
- 200 g mixed berries
Instructions
-
1.
Place the cookies in a clean kitchen towel and crush them into crumbs with a rolling pin. Melt butter in a small pot over low heat and mix with the crumbs and oats.
-
2.
Line a springform pan with parchment paper and press the cookie mixture firmly into the bottom.
-
3.
For the filling, whisk vanilla powder, cream cheese, sour cream, and sugar until smooth. Add eggs one at a time, then stir in cornstarch briefly.
-
4.
Spread the filling over the crust and bake in a preheated oven at 180 °C (160 °C fan‑forced; gas: level 2–3) for 1 hour. Remove the cheesecake from the pan with a knife and let it cool.
-
5.
Meanwhile wash, trim, and cut the berries into small pieces. Puree them to make a sauce and serve over the cake.
